JavaScript est un langage de programmation polyvalent et largement utilisé qui joue un rôle essentiel dans le développement web moderne. Que vous soyez novice en programmation ou un développeur chevronné, il est important de comprendre les bases de JavaScript et son importance pour créer des applications web interactives et dynamiques. Dans cet article, nous explorerons les fondamentaux de JavaScript et son impact sur le développement web.

Fondamentaux de JavaScript : JavaScript est un langage de programmation interprété, orienté objet et basé sur des prototypes. Il est principalement utilisé pour programmer des interactions côté client dans les pages web, telles que la manipulation du contenu, les animations, les formulaires interactifs et la gestion des événements. JavaScript s’exécute directement dans le navigateur web, ce qui signifie qu’aucune installation supplémentaire n’est nécessaire pour exécuter des scripts JavaScript sur une page web.

Syntaxe et fonctionnalités clés : La syntaxe de JavaScript est similaire à celle des autres langages de programmation, ce qui facilite son apprentissage pour les développeurs familiarisés avec d’autres langages. JavaScript offre de nombreuses fonctionnalités puissantes, telles que la manipulation du DOM (Document Object Model) pour interagir avec les éléments HTML, les tableaux, les boucles, les fonctions, les objets et bien plus encore. Il prend également en charge les concepts avancés tels que les fonctions anonymes, les rappels (callbacks) et les promesses pour gérer l’asynchronisme.

Intégration avec HTML et CSS : JavaScript s’intègre étroitement avec HTML et CSS pour créer des sites web interactifs. Il peut être utilisé pour modifier dynamiquement le contenu HTML, appliquer des styles CSS, valider les données des formulaires et gérer les événements tels que les clics de souris et les saisies au clavier. Grâce à cette intégration étroite, JavaScript permet de créer des expériences utilisateur fluides et dynamiques.

Frameworks et bibliothèques : JavaScript dispose d’une vaste collection de frameworks et de bibliothèques qui simplifient le développement web. Des frameworks populaires tels que React, Angular et Vue.js facilitent la création d’interfaces utilisateur interactives et réactives. Les bibliothèques comme jQuery simplifient la manipulation du DOM et offrent des fonctionnalités supplémentaires pour faciliter le développement.

Évolution et utilisation étendue : Au fil des ans, JavaScript a évolué pour devenir un langage de programmation polyvalent utilisé dans divers contextes, y compris le développement web, les applications mobiles, les applications de bureau et même le développement côté serveur avec Node.js. Il est soutenu par une communauté dynamique qui contribue à son évolution constante et à l’émergence de nouvelles fonctionnalités et de meilleures pratiques.

Conclusion : JavaScript est un langage de programmation essentiel pour le développement web moderne. Grâce à sa syntaxe simple, à ses fonctionnalités puissantes et à son intégration étroite avec HTML et CSS, il permet de créer des applications web interactives et dynamiques. Que vous soyez un développeur débutant ou expérimenté, maîtriser JavaScript est un atout précieux pour construire des expériences utilisateur exceptionnelles

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*